Company Description

Exela Technologies, Inc. delivers a range of business solutions globally, focusing on transaction processing, managing enterprise information, document handling, and digitalizing business operations. The company organizes its services across three primary divisions: Information & Transaction Processing Solutions (ITPS), Healthcare Solutions (HS), and Legal & Loss Prevention Services (LLPS). The ITPS segment caters to a broad spectrum of industries. It provides lending solutions for mortgage and automotive loans, alongside banking services such as clearing, anti-money laundering efforts, sanctions compliance, and cross-border interbank settlements. For the property and casualty insurance sector, ITPS offers support for policy origination, enrollments, claims processing, and benefits communication. Public sector clients benefit from solutions covering income tax processing, benefits administration, and records management. This segment further includes payment processing and reconciliation, integrated management of accounts receivable and payable, document logistics, location-based services, physical records archiving, and electronic data storage. It also supplies the necessary software, hardware, professional services, and maintenance to automate information and transaction workflows. The HS segment is dedicated to the healthcare market, serving both payers and providers. Its offerings include revenue cycle management, integrated accounts payable and receivable systems, and comprehensive information management services. Lastly, the LLPS segment manages the administration of legal claims, particularly for class action and mass action settlements. This involves offering project management support, notifying claimants, conducting outreach programs, and efficiently collecting, analyzing, and distributing settlement funds. Furthermore, LLPS provides specialized data and analytical services, encompassing litigation consulting, economic and statistical analysis, expert witness testimony, and revenue recovery for delinquent accounts. Exela Technologies maintains its corporate headquarters in Irving, Texas.
